About The Position

We are seeking a hard-working, enthusiastic, and dependable Medical Assistant to support one physician in a busy Ear, Nose & Throat (ENT) group practice. Our practice treats patients of all ages, from newborns to seniors. The Medical Assistant is a critical member of the clinical team, responsible for both clinical and administrative duties. While patients are in the clinic, the MA interviews patients, documents directly in the EMR, schedules tests and procedures, assists with minor in-office procedures, and supports efficient patient flow. This role also includes answering and triaging patient phone calls, managing referrals, and coordinating care with outside specialists. A clear understanding that medicine is a service industry and the patient is the customer is essential.

Responsibilities

  • Greet patients and escort them from the waiting room to exam rooms
  • Collect detailed patient histories and document accurately in the EMR
  • Review prior chart entries and become familiar with established patients
  • Measure and record vital signs
  • Answer phones and manage patient inquiries
  • Manage and process referrals, including sending records to outside specialists
  • Obtain faxed medical records from referring physicians
  • Schedule tests, procedures, and follow-up appointments
  • Assist physicians with minor in-office procedures
  • Clean and sanitize exam rooms between patients
  • Keep exam rooms stocked and organized
  • Clean and sterilize medical equipment
  • Contact insurance companies to obtain prior authorizations
  • Manage prescription refill requests
  • Triage patient phone calls, review concerns with the physician, and respond appropriately
  • Help keep the clinic and physician on schedule
  • Maintain clean, organized nursing and patient care areas
